The Los Angeles-based band&#8217;s live show is a rock concert with touches of cabaret, vaudeville, church revival, circus and medicine show. It&#8217;s a spectacle.<\/p>\n<p class=\"STND-STND BodyText\">&#8220;There&#8217;s not a lot of bands going out with 15 people and dancers,&#8221; said bandleader Andy Comeau, who performs as &#8220;Vaud Overstreet.&#8221; &#8220;So we have that either on our side or going against us in some ways. People don&#8217;t know what they&#8217;re in for. And it&#8217;s fun to see people go, &#8216;Wow!&#8217; It&#8217;s just a winning night.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p class=\"STND-STND BodyText\">This diverse crew of musicians and dancers will headline the Wheeler Opera House on New Year&#8217;s Eve, returning to the historic theater after playing one of the first concerts at the Wheeler Opera House&#8217;s &#8220;On the Rise&#8221; series in 2016, which blew away an autumn offseason crowd with its all-out assault of sights and sounds. Wheeler executive director Gena Buhler knew she had a winning New Year&#8217;s act on her hands.<\/p>\n<p class=\"STND-STND BodyText\">&#8220;Immediately after the show, on the side of the stage, Gena was asking us about playing New Year&#8217;s,&#8221; Overstreet recalled. &#8220;It was in all of our minds that this would be a good fit for that night.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p class=\"STND-STND BodyText\">Founded by the husband-and-wife musical team of Comeau and Dawn Lewis, whose stage name is &#8220;Peaches Mahoney,&#8221; the unconventional jazz orchestra has its origins in Bruce Springsteen&#8217;s 2006 album &#8220;We Shall Overcome,&#8221; on which The Boss paid tribute to the American activist folk tradition with his one-off 13-member Seeger Sessions band.<\/p>\n<p class=\"STND-STND BodyText\">Comeau had been playing in a traditional blues band when he and Lewis got into the record. The Seeger Sessions Band compelled them to try to recreate that wild old-time sound with a massive ensemble of musicians. They put an ad on Craigslist looking for musicians who were into that kind of thing.<\/p>\n<div id=\"single-mid-script\" class=\"p402_hide\">\n<h2>Recommended Stories For You<\/h2>\n<\/p><\/div>\n<p class=\"STND-STND BodyText\">&#8220;We wanted to emulate the sound of it somehow,&#8221; Lewis recalled. &#8220;Everyone wants to be near some magic like that. I&#8217;m thankful it originated with that idea in mind.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p class=\"STND-STND BodyText\">The dancers and more theatrical elements of the show had a simpler origin.<\/p>\n<p class=\"STND-STND BodyText\">&#8220;We got drunk one night and we said, &#8216;We&#8217;re going to have this band and were going to have dancers!'&#8221; Lewis recalled with a laugh.<\/p>\n<p class=\"STND-STND BodyText\">The band squeezes into the studio to write and record its original music. In May, Vaud and the Villains released the genre-hopping album &#8220;Bigger Than It Looks.&#8221; It&#8217;s filled with intricate danceable compositions that put a contemporary spin on old-time folk and rock traditions.<\/p>\n<p class=\"STND-STND BodyText\">Vaud and the Villains rehearse in a converted garage in Los Angeles \u2014 Lewis described these sessions as &#8220;complete and utter chaos&#8221; \u2014 where they work out the meticulous songs in various combinations of singers, instrumentalists and dancers. They put it all together for stage spectacles like the one coming to Aspen.<\/p>\n<p class=\"STND-STND BodyText\">Asked if they were working on anything special planned for the New Year&#8217;s Eve show, Comeau quipped: &#8220;One of the band members is not really a human.
